BONDS PLEDGED TO THE CREDIT FACILITY ISSUER Sample Clauses

BONDS PLEDGED TO THE CREDIT FACILITY ISSUER. The Bond Registrar shall register (or the Depository shall record) in the name of the Company any Bonds delivered to the Tender Agent pursuant to Section 307(A)(2) hereof. Thereafter, the Tender Agent shall hold such Bonds unless and until the Tender Agent shall have received from the Credit Facility Issuer written notice or telephonic notice, promptly confirmed in writing, which specifies that the Tender Agent shall deliver such Bonds to the Company or the Remarketing Agent. Upon receipt of such notice, the Tender Agent shall deliver such Bonds to the Company or the Remarketing Agent.

  • Letter of Credit Facility Subject to the terms hereof, Issuing Lender will, from time to time and for its own account and not on behalf of the Lenders, upon request by Borrower, issue one or more Letters of Credit for the account of Borrower, provided that (i) the aggregate face amount of such Letters of Credit (including the amount of the requested Letter of Credit but exclusive of the SBID Letter of Credit) does not exceed $500,000, and (ii) each Letter of Credit shall have an expiration date no later than one year from issuance or the Maturity Date. If the requested Letter of Credit will be an extension of the SBID Letter of Credit, such SBID Letter of Credit shall not be in an amount greater than the lesser of (i) $1,105,743.00 or (ii) the Borrowing Base minus the aggregate principal amount of all Revolving Loans. As an additional condition to the issuance of any Letter of Credit, Borrower shall execute and deliver Issuing Lender's customary Letter of Credit application and shall pay to Issuing Lender for its account only a Letter of Credit fee, payable quarterly in advance, beginning with the date of issuance and each January 1, April 1, July 1 and October 1 thereafter, in an amount equal to the greater of (i) $500.00 or (ii) one and one-quarter percent (1.25%) per annum (pro-rated for periods of less than one year) of the unfunded face amount thereof. Such Letter of Credit shall be issued in form satisfactory to Issuing Lender. The amount, if any, from time to time drawn by the beneficiary of a Letter of Credit shall be reimbursed and paid by Borrower to Issuing Lender ON DEMAND, or, at Issuing Lender's option, charged as a Revolving Loan to Borrower pursuant to SECTION 2.1(a), whether or not Borrower would then be entitled to an Advance for such amount pursuant to SECTION 2.1(a); Lenders are authorized to make any such Loan on the request of Issuing Lender; provided, however, if such Loan would cause the aggregate amount of the Loans then outstanding (including the Loan to be made with respect to the reimbursement of the Letter of Credit) to exceed the Borrowing Base, the amount of such Loan equal to such excess shall be made solely by the Lender who is also the Issuing Lender. The reimbursement obligations and all other obligations of Borrower to Issuing Lender with respect to all Letters of Credit shall be secured by Liens in the Collateral that rank PARI PASSU with the Liens of the Lenders in the Collateral; accordingly each Dollar realized on the Collateral and the proceeds thereof shall be shared by the Lenders, on the one hand, and the Issuing Lender, on the other hand, in the proportion that the Obligations (determined without inclusion of any Letter of Credit Exposure) and the Letter of Credit Exposure bears to one another; provided, however, in determining the Letter of Credit Exposure of the Issuing Lender, all Letter of Credit Exposure, contingent or otherwise, shall be included in any calculation; provided, further, that if the Issuing Lender receives any proceeds of Collateral on account of any Letter of Credit which, at the time of receipt of the proceeds, may still be drawn upon and which thereafter expires without being drawn upon, then such proceeds shall be reallocated among the Lenders and the Issuing Lender on the basis of a new determination of Obligations and Letter of Credit Exposure. Prior to such reallocation or the application of such proceeds to unpaid reimbursement obligations of Borrower to Issuing Lender, Issuing Lender shall hold such proceeds in an interest bearing cash collateral account (the "CASH COLLATERAL ACCOUNT") which shall be in the name of and under the sole dominion and control of Issuing Lender for the benefit of itself and Lenders pursuant to the terms hererof. Borrower agrees to execute and deliver to Issuing Lender such documentation with respect to the Cash Collateral Account as Issuing Lender may request and hereby pledges and grants to Issuing Lender, for the benefit of Issuing Lender and Lenders, a security interest in all such proceeds and funds held in the Cash Collateral Account from time to time and all interest thereon, claims and choses in action in respect thereof, and the proceeds thereof, as additional security for the payment of all amounts due in respect of the Letter of Credit Exposure, whether or not then due, and all other Obligations.

  • Collateral Account and Security Interest At any time when Fund’s assets are below $15 million, the Advisor, for value received, hereby pledges, assigns, sets over and grants to the Trust a continuing security interest in and to an account to be established and maintained by the Advisor with the Securities Intermediary and designated as a collateral account (the “Collateral Account”), including any replacement account established with any successor, together with all dividends, interest, stock-splits, distributions, profits and all cash and non-cash proceeds thereof and any and all other rights as may now or hereafter derive or accrue therefrom (collectively, the “Collateral”) to secure the payment of any required Fund Reimbursement Payment or Liquidation Expenses (as defined in Paragraph 5 of this Agreement). For so long as this Agreement is in effect, any transfers or conveyances of Collateral to any party shall require the approval of the Board of Trustees of the Trust (the “Board”), except as specified in Section 7(a)(ii) of this Agreement, below. In addition, the Trust will not issue entitlement orders, redeem or otherwise take any action with respect to the Collateral or Collateral Account unless a Collateral Event (defined below under Section 5 of this Agreement) has occurred or is continuing.

  • Collateral Event In the event that either (a) the Advisor does not make the Fund Reimbursement Payment due in connection with a particular calendar month by the tenth day of the following calendar month or (b) the Board enacts a resolution calling for the liquidation of the Fund (either (a) or (b), a “Collateral Event”), then, in either event, the Board shall have absolute discretion to redeem any shares or other Collateral held in the Collateral Account and utilize the proceeds from such redemptions or such other Collateral to make any required Fund Reimbursement Payment, or to cover any costs or expenses which the Board, in its sole and absolute discretion, estimates will be required in connection with the liquidation of the Fund (the “Liquidation Expenses”). Pursuant to the terms of Paragraph 6 of this Agreement, upon authorization from the Board, but subject to the provisions of the Control Agreement, no further instructions shall be required from the Advisor for the Securities Intermediary to transfer any Collateral from the Collateral Account to the Fund. The Advisor acknowledges that in the event the Collateral available in the Collateral Account is insufficient to cover the full cost of any Fund Reimbursement Payment or Liquidation Expenses, the Fund shall retain the right to receive from the Advisor any costs in excess of the value of the Collateral.
